Hollywood stars Will Smith and Martin Lawrence took to the social media streets on Tuesday 31 January to confirm that Bad Boys 4 is officially in early pre-production.
--
The actors will once again reprise the roles of Miami narcotics detectives Mike Lowrey and Marcus Burnett for the latest instalment of the popular action-comedy franchise.

-- Bad Boys' and good money According to Deadline, before the COVID-pandemic brought Tinseltown to a standstill in March 2020, the third movie, Bad Boys for Life, made more than $426 million at the worldwide box office Altogether, the Bad Boys franchise have earned an incredible $840.7 million at the global box office.

Image: AFP/ Frederic J BROWN Why the long wait? After the original Bad Boys was released in 1995, eight long years passed until the sequel Bad Boys 2 hit the big screen in 2003.
In 2015, Sony Pictures announced plans for the production of a third and even a fourth movie. But various pre-production issues involving the directors, screenwriters, and cast delayed the process, and so the primary focus eventually became Bad Boys for Life, as reported by Screenrant.

Image: Supplied/ Sony Sony Pictures was officially developing Bad Boys 4, which they confirmed the day Bad Boys For Life was released in theatres. The film remained stuck in production hell with rumours doing the rounds that Sony delayed Bad Boys 4 due to the controversy surrounding the Oscars slap.
Sony however denied any connection between the delay in production and the so-called Slapgate .
Bad Boys 4': Possible plot Bad Boys 3 ended with a twist
Armando Armas is Mike Lowrey's son. Before partnering up with Marcus, Mike worked undercover in Mexico and formed a romantic relationship with the stone-cold killer Isabel Aretas.
In Bad Boys for Life's climax, Isabel falls to her death and Mike reveals the truth to Armando. Bad Boys For Life s post-credits scene teases a possible storyline for Bad Boys 4, as Mike informs his son about a potential opportunity to repay his debts to society.
If Screenrant's prediction is anything to go by, Bad Boys 4 might just involve Armando working with the AMMO task force, with Smith and Lawrence stepping into the buddy cop roles, of course.
